Area of Science:

  • Mechanical Engineering
  • Signal Processing
  • Artificial Intelligence

Background:

  • Bearing failures in mechanical systems can lead to severe consequences.
  • Current manual parameter adjustment methods for fault diagnosis are inefficient and prone to local optima.
  • There is a need for automated, globally optimal bearing fault diagnosis.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To propose a novel, optimized method for bearing fault diagnosis.
  • To improve the accuracy and reliability of bearing fault detection.
  • To overcome limitations of traditional manual and automated methods.

Main Methods:

  • Utilizing wavelet packet transform for bearing vibration signal analysis and spectrogram generation.
  • Employing a convolutional neural network (CNN) for feature extraction and classification.
  • Optimizing CNN parameters using a simulated annealing (SA) algorithm for global optimization.

Main Results:

  • The proposed method demonstrated superior performance in diagnosing bearing faults.
  • Validation using the Case Western Reserve University bearing dataset confirmed effectiveness.
  • Comparative analysis showed better results than traditional machine learning and deep learning methods.

Conclusions:

  • The integrated approach of wavelet packet transform, CNN, and SA offers a robust solution for bearing fault diagnosis.
  • This method provides a more reliable and globally optimized alternative to existing techniques.
  • The findings suggest significant potential for industrial applications in predictive maintenance.
